📌 1. Product Definition & Classification: What Exactly is "Polypropylene Ribbon"?

Polypropylene (PP) Ribbons are synthetic textile products widely used in packaging, gift wrapping, garment accessories, and crafting. In international trade, the classification depends heavily on the manufacturing process (torn, woven, or non-woven) and the final physical form (strip, cord, or elastic band).

⚠️ Key Distinction Point:
- If the ribbon is a plastic strip (often torn from a web) without the structure of woven fabric, it may fall under Chapter 39 (Plastics) or Chapter 56 (Wadding/Felt/Non-wovens).
- If the ribbon is woven or twisted yarn, it generally falls under Chapter 56 (Yarns/Strips).
- If it functions as an elastic band (even if low elasticity), it may be classified under Plastics or Textiles depending on specific legal notes.

✅ 3. Special Situation Handling

Situation Handling Advice
Mixed Materials If ribbon contains cotton/polyester blend, it may shift to Textile chapters (Chapter 54/55). Check composition!
Floral Pattern Printing Printing does not change the HS Code. It is still a PP ribbon.
Customs Inquiry If customs asks for "Textile vs. Plastic", provide a microscopy report or manufacturer's process description (e.g., "Thermally torn from PP web").
Low Value Shipments No De Minimis Exemption. Even small packages are subject to full tax.

协调制度(HS)是由世界海关组织(WCO)制定的国际贸易商品分类标准。全球 200 多个国家采用 HS 系统作为海关关税、贸易统计和进出口监管的基础。

每个 HS 编码遵循以下层级结构:

  • 章(2 位)——商品大类(例如:第 84 章:机器和机械设备)
  • 品目(4 位)——章内的更具体分类
  • 子目(6 位)——国际通用细分,所有 WCO 成员国统一使用
  • 本国细分(8-10 位)——各国自行扩展的细分编码,如美国 HTSUS 10 位编码

正确的 HS 编码归类对于顺利通关、准确缴纳关税和遵守贸易法规至关重要。错误归类可能导致海关延误、多缴关税或罚款。
